
Building 429 is sending a special thank you to all of its fans to celebrate on "4/29" (Monday, April 29). The band will be streaming the complete new album, We Won't Be Shaken, for one day only on its website, www.Building429.com. It's a sneak peek of the new project that releases June 4 and the group's way of saying thank you to all of the fans who have shown such incredible support over the years.
Fans across the country are getting a chance to hear the new music live with Building 429's headlining spring "Give Me Jesus" Tour with the Rhett Walker Band, Finding Favour and Carlos Whittaker. The group was nominated this week for its first Billboard Music Award for Top Christian Song of the Year with the major 2012 breakout single, "Where I Belong."
